Maxi Perrone is set to join Como on a permanent €13m transfer from Manchester City.
Reports in Italy claim that Argentine midfielder Perrone is set to remain at Como permanently.
The 22-year-old spent the last season on loan at the Stadio Sinigaglia, but according to Gazzetta and Fabrizio Romano, the two clubs have now reached an agreement over a permanent transfer.
Romano claims that Manchester City have allowed Perrone to undergo medical tests with Cesc Fabregas’ side before completing a €13m transfer.
Perrone made 26 appearances with Como in 2024-25, producing three assists.
Perrone spent several months on the sidelines during his first Serie A season due to physical issues, but he received regular playing time when he was fit to play.
Perrone had made just two senior appearances for Manchester City before joining Como on loan last summer.
He has also played for Velez and Las Palmas.
Como will make their 2025-26 Serie A debut at home against Lazio on August 24.
